Quick heads-up: while the Orveston building gets its facelift, we're running visitors through the temporary annex on Calder Row. It's a bit of a squeeze, so please book guests in a day ahead where you can. Everyone signs the sheet at the annex desk, grabs a sticker badge, and waits for their host — no wandering, the corridors are half construction zone. The annex side door stays locked; the current entry code is below.

staff pass of kawip-hawef = bdg-QLP-2

## Runbook: Cron Drift on Plugin Hosts

If your plugin's scheduled jobs fire late on Tembric's worker pool, check drift first. Run the drift probe shipped with the Lattercane SDK against the host's cron daemon and compare offsets over three cycles. Anything above 400ms means the host clock is slewing; file a capacity note rather than patching your plugin. After confirming drift, re-register your plugin with the scheduler, which requires the signing credential in your env file. Add the following line to plugin.env:

vault entry, yajop-bafop: ARCHIVE_KEY3=8d4

Step 4: The stale-cache saga. Remember the Fernwick outage where checkout showed last week's prices? Root cause was the CDN purge job silently failing. This deploy adds a purge verification step — don't skip it, even if it adds two minutes. Confirm the purge receipt in the dashboard, then sign the release manifest with the key below.

deploy key for kajof-fajop: bky6_gDHw9Q